Build a Sales Funnel
A sales funnel is a series of steps designed to convert visitors into customers. It’s important to start with the right audience segment and engage them at each step before ultimately completing the sale. To determine how best to build your sales funnel, you will want to research your target audience, identify the benefits they would enjoy after purchasing your product or service, and pinpoint specific call-to-actions that will help them accomplish those goals.

Use Google Ads
An excellent way to maximize conversions is through a Google Ads bid strategy. Depending on the types of goals you want to pursue, you can create a bidding strategy that tracks either impressions, clicks, or in this case, conversions. Among them, we have:

- Target Cost
- Target CPA (cost per action)
- Maximize Conversions
- Maximize Conversion Value
- Enhanced cost per click (ECPC)
Smart bidding strategies are automated bidding strategies that focus more on conversions. Inside smart bidding strategies, maximize conversion bidding focuses on generating as many conversions as possible while managing your daily budget.
This tool analyzes historical information about your campaign and finds an optimal bid for your ad each time it’s eligible to appear based on user searches.
